SERVICES




SECURITY ALARMS

> A security alarm is the first and most important form of protection for you
> and your property.

We offer exterior/interior perimeter, motion and smoke detection to ensure you
are protected to the highest level. Most of the devices we incorporate today are
pet friendly with anti masking/tamper proof redundancies incorporated in the
devices to eliminate false alarms or damage.

Using the latest systems, you can remotely access your alarm system. Arm or
disarm your alarm at the touch of a button, or open the gate/garage to allow
access when you’re not there.

PREWIRING

Prewiring is an easy way to hardwire an alarm system exactly where you want it.
Whether it’s a new build or your renovating, our security consultant will advise
on the ideal locations with you, then our licensed security technicians will run
the cabling, ideally once the electrician has completed his cabling and just
before the insulation goes in. Security cable is much more fragile than most
other cables so this needs to be strategically run to avoid electrical
interference and damage.

UPGRADES

Has your old alarm started to have a mind of its own, buttons stopped working or
have you upgraded your network to digital and can’t use traditional
communication methods such as a landline anymore? We will upgrade your old
system, keeping the existing cabling and if required adding new devices with the
latest Paradox systems. Paradox’s IP150 internet module allows for digital
communication via your smart phone or to a 24/7 back to base monitoring station.
We also have GPRS cellular modules that can be monitored if you have no modem
onsite.

ALARM SERVICING & REPAIR

Although we choose to install Paradox alarms, we can service most brands such as
DSC, Bosch and Micron. Alarms 15 year and older, generally need to be upgraded,
as even after a service, they can fall over. An annual service by our licenced
technicians includes, cleaning sensors, checking cables, replacing wireless
batteries or the backup battery and a full functional test.

Additional programming of an alarm will require the installer code for us to
access the system. This can usually be obtained by your installer. If you don’t
have or know your installer code, then we can usually default the alarm system
and reprogram it. If it is “locked” then we won’t be able to do this.

CCTV

CCTV is now a cost-effective way to protect you and your assets when you’re not
there! Using high quality brands such as Hikvision and Trendnet, IP cameras
today are full HD and can be remotely accessed via apps on your smart phones or
computers for remote viewing.

Recorders are available in 4/8/16/32 channels, so we can provide video
protection for any environment.

PREWIRING

Prewiring is an easy way to install CCTV cameras exactly where you want them.
Whether it’s a new build or your renovating, our security consultant will advise
on the ideal locations with you, then our licensed security technicians will run
the cabling. One the build is complete, we will return and fit off the Cameras,
program, test and provide full user training.

NEW INSTALLS

Most IP based CCTV systems only require one cable to run from the camera back to
the NVR (Network Video Recorder). We will assess the ideal locations to install
cameras based on your requirements. Wireless IP cameras are also available, but
at a bit more of a cost.

MONITORING/COMMUNICATION OPTIONS

As the communication world is changing to digital from analogue, most of the
older alarms that communicated to you or a monitoring station via the copper
landline are becoming obsolete.

Some older alarms can use the new digital or cellular networks, but most are
required to be upgraded to allow protection of your assets to continue.

DIGITAL CONNECTIONS

As we move away from traditional landlines, one of the most popular ways to have
your alarm communicate to you is via an IP module. Paradox’s IP150 module allows
to self-monitor via your smartphone and receive email notifications and/or
communicate to a monitoring station via your network. Some older alarms can be
monitored only using the

IP150 via your network, but you will require the latest Paradox system for
remote access technology.

GPRS/GSM CONNECTIONS

GPRS modules use the cellular network to communicate to a monitoring station.
They can use single or dual sim card (Spark/Vodafone) and communicate every 4
hours, 1 hour or 120seconds to a monitoring station. Ideal if digital isn’t
convenient or even as a backup if your digital connection fails. GPRS modules
run off the backup power supply of the alarm, so even if you have a power cut,
GPRS will still communicate.

GSM modules such as the GPRS260 from Paradox is generally used for a SIM based
self-monitoring communication device. All you need is to supply a SIM card and
our licenced technicians will install and program up to 16 numbers the GSM
module can send instant text notifications to. You can even text to arm/disarm
the alarm system.

TRADITIONAL CONNECTIONS

While it’s a losing battle for traditional copper phone connections, they are
still very reliable. Any alarm with a contact ID output can be monitored or
setup to call you directly if the alarm activates. If you have removed your
landline, then you may want to have a look at our IP or GPRS communication
options.




ACCESS CONTROL

> Commercial access controls systems are crucial for staff and security
> management.

We use the latest Paradox EVOHD system to offer up to 32 access controlled
doors, 999 users, 192 zones and up to 8 separate partitions. If it’s 200sqm or
5000sqm, the EVOHD can accommodate your requirements.

The NeWare end user software and pin/swipe readers allow management to control
and manage staff access levels, contractors or temp staff’s movements,
restricting them to where they only need to be.

We can install new or upgrade older access control systems.




INTERCOMS

> Intercoms are a convenient method of identifying who is at your gate or door.

The systems we use are of the highest quality. As intercoms are generally
outside, we use marine proof outdoor keypads and locks to ensure longevity.
Cheaper devices will eventually rust or deteriorate much quicker and will need
to be replaced sooner.

The Panasonic intercom system has two way audio communication, hardwired full
colour screen, wireless monitor for convenience and gate release options if you
have an electric lock. Presco outdoor keypads and Assa Abloy electric locks are
our preferred brands. We can upgrade old intercoms or install a new system. Our
licenced security consultant will provide a detailed assessment of what is
required to install your new intercom unit.
